Background:
- Coxsackievirus 16 (CA16) is a primary cause of hand, foot, and mouth disease (HFMD) in children.
- CA16 and enterovirus 71 (EV71) co-circulation in the Western Pacific presents a significant public health challenge.
- While typically mild, CA16 infections are now associated with severe and fatal outcomes.
Purpose of the Study:
- To investigate the evolving clinical and virological characteristics of CA16.
- To understand the impact of CA16 and EV71 co-infections on disease severity and epidemiology.
- To guide the development of diagnostic tools and vaccines for CA16.
Main Methods:
- Review of recent epidemiological data on CA16 and EV71 outbreaks.
- Analysis of clinical case reports detailing severe CA16 infections.
- Examination of studies on viral co-infection and genetic recombination.
Main Results:
- CA16 is implicated in an increasing number of severe and fatal HFMD cases.
- Co-infection with EV71 exacerbates central nervous system complications.
- Genetic recombination between CA16 and EV71 may drive large-scale outbreaks, as seen in China in 2008.
Conclusions:
- CA16 poses a growing threat beyond its traditionally mild presentation.
- Understanding CA16-EV71 interactions is crucial for managing HFMD outbreaks.
- Further research into CA16 virology is essential for effective control strategies.
Abstract:
Coxsackievirus 16 (CA16) is one of the major pathogens associated with hand, foot, and mouth disease (HFMD) in infants and young children. In recent years, CA16 and human enterovirus 71 (EV71) have often circulated alternatively or together in the Western Pacific region, which has become an important public health problem in this region. HFMD caused by CA16 infection is generally thought to be mild and self-limiting. However, recently several severe and fatal cases involving CA16 have been reported. Studies have shown that co-infection with CA16 and EV71 can cause serious complications in the central nervous system (CNS) and increase the chance of genetic recombination, which may be responsible for the large HFMD outbreak in Mainland China in 2008. For these reasons, recent studies have focused on the virological characteristics of CA16 and the development of CA16-related diagnostic reagents and vaccines.
